Radiation Exposure and Adverse Health Effects of Interventional Cardiology Staff
Coronary angiography (CA), perc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I), catheter-based structural heart intervention, electrophysiological studies, and arrhythmia ablation are procedures that help cardiologists ensure better clinical diagnosis and treatment (Dawkins et al. 2005). During these procedures, catheters, guide wires, and other devices are visualized and guided by using real-time fluoroscopy. Therefore, operators are inevitably exposed to radiation (Kim and Miller 2009). Compared to other departments (radiology, urology, operating rooms, etc.), the cardiovascular or catheterization laboratory is generally considered to be an area of high radiation exposure (Raza 2011). Interventional cardiology (IC) staff is exposed more radiation per year than are radiologists by a factor of two to three (Picano et al. 2007). Invasive cardiology procedures have increased tenfold in the past decade, and growth in the field has been accompanied by concern for the safety of such staff (Picano et al. 2007).
